Clinical Trial Shows Pycnogenol Significantly Relieves Lipedema Symptoms
A study published in Cureus Journal of Medical Science shows that Pycnogenol from Horphag Research (Switzerland) can significantly relieve the symptoms of lipedema, reduce body fat and improve self-esteem associated with the condition. According to Horphag, lipedema is a chronic, often misunderstood condition that affects about 400 million women globally. It causes an abnormal and ...

Study Finds Pycnogenol May Ease Symptoms of Fibromyalgia
In a promising natural path breakthrough for fibromyalgia sufferers, a new peer-reviewed and published pilot study shows that daily supplementation with Pycnogenol may support reduction of symptoms associated with the condition, including fatigue, migraines, and stiffness. In the study, Pycnogenol, French maritime pine bark extract, significantly reduced oxidative stress and the need for analgesics. Data shows ...
